Passing the National Registry of Emergency Medical Technicians (NREMT) EMT Exam is a major milestone for anyone beginning a career in emergency medical services. The exam evaluates your ability to assess patients, make sound clinical decisions, and provide safe, effective prehospital care in a wide range of emergency situations. Success requires more than memorizing facts—it demands critical thinking and the ability to apply EMT knowledge under pressure.

Prepare for the National EMT Exam with Confidence
The National EMT exam uses scenario-based questions to evaluate your clinical judgment and ability to prioritize patient care. You’ll need to recognize life-threatening conditions, perform accurate assessments, select appropriate interventions, and make decisions based on established EMS protocols.
Working through realistic practice questions helps you become familiar with the adaptive style of the exam while reinforcing essential emergency care concepts.
